Revocation of Driving Rights for Violations: Ukrainians Reminded How to Retrieve Their Driver's License.


How to Restore Driving Rights
The revocation of driving rights for violating rules is a serious measure that requires attention to the procedure for returning the driver's license. After the expiration of the revocation period, many drivers have questions about the correct and legal retrieval of their rights.
In order to retrieve the driver's document after revocation for violations, it is necessary to:
- pass a medical examination;
- take theoretical and practical exams at the Ministry of Internal Affairs Driving School.
For drivers with a two-year driver's license, the procedure for restoring driving rights has a special process. In this case, it is necessary to undergo a full training course at a driving school, which includes:
- Theoretical preparation - studying traffic rules, safety, and technical aspects of vehicle control
- Practical part - driving lessons with an instructor
Only after successfully completing the course and passing exams, the driver will be able to receive a new license. This requirement is aimed at ensuring road safety and confirming the necessary driving skills.
